Co-localization of mu-opioid receptor-like and substance P-like immunoreactivities in axon terminals within the superficial layers of the medullary and spinal dorsal horns of the rat.

Y Q Ding1, S Nomura, T Kaneko, N Mizuno.   

Abstract

The presence of mu-opioid receptor-like immunoreactivity (MOR-LI) on axon terminals was confirmed by light and electron microscopy within the superficial layers of the medullary and spinal dorsal horns of the rat. By means of double-immunofluorescence histochemistry, co-localization of MOR-LI and substance P (SP)-LI was occasionally observed in axon terminals within the superficial layers of the dorsal horns.
